Do the good in the world vanish?   What is the reward for a person who does selfless duty?  How far he can wait for the reward for our good deeds?   Can good people live with the corrupted system surrounding us?   One day, when everybody start cursing and go against us can we hold on to the truth and stare at the fate?


Versatile actor director Sreenivasan's Katha Parayumbol is in news for one reason it is a good cinema and for the other, Superstar Rajnikanth has selected this movie for his next venture (tentatively titled as Kuselan).


The movie is all about Barber Balan (Sreenivasan) who found happiness in his small living circumstances but didn't allow the outside world to corrupt his mind.   He was a helping friend, a loving husband and father.    He maintains his family with the small income from his barber shop.   Even though his income is quite low he wishes that his children should grow wise and try his best to teach them in the city schools but find it difficult to maintain.   The children love their father, but they are always demanding.   The barber is simple, but he has a cunning tongue which often throws strong arrows which disturb others.   When another Barber shop with modern facilities arrived to the village, the existence of Balan and his shop fall into danger.  His various attempts for recovery failed miserably.   He realized that the only way to compete with the other barber is to modernize his shop with a revolving chair and equipments.  He approached all the sources and tried all his tricks including reducing the prices…but without much success.  He was not ready to


bribe or to take money for high interest.


The village and people were excited with the news that the Superstar Asok Raj (Mammootty) is arriving to the nearby village for shooting.   Interestingly, the superstar was classmate of Balan.   His wife (Mena) and children start demanding that they have to meet the superstar, where the news spread like wildfire that Balan is classmate to the superstar.   Everybody is in a pleasing mode to Balan and their family where Balan is not ready to use his friendship.  Still he tries to meet his old friend, but it is not easy to get in touch with a Super star.  From here on, Balan spend disturbing days and sleepless nights.   Does he succeed in his attempt to meet his school friend?  What will be the reaction of the old friend?   Whether Balan's good deeds will be returned? …See the film to have the complete story.


Like Sreenivasan's other films, script is the master for this too.   The story starts around a beautiful hilly village and lead us to the warmth and struggles of a village life.  It moves in the same pace most of the time, but the climax was brilliantly penned and well executed.   The entire scenes got a meaning and the end scenes added more than value to the film to make it different from a light entertainer.   The script writer succeeds in his attempt to spread the value of friendship.


He also use the film to spread his observations about movies, script writers, the crisis film industry faces etc. too in sidelines.   At the end of the day we can observe that it is the success of the script writing which was pictured to frames by the newcomer director M Mohanan.    Here the merit of the director may be shadowed by the presence of Sreenivasan, but it is natural for any one who stands near a big tree like Sreeni and his multi-talents.  The central message the film gives around the movie industry is that don't blame the audience for the genre of films they like, but the writers and directors should go with their convictions and it is their duty to present the film for the entertainment and enjoyment of the audience.


As an actor Sreenivasan was quite average, nothing exceptional.   (I wish Rajni is playing the role played by Sreenivasan and not the one played by Mammootty.)   The role of Mammootty was limited but he shown his class in the climax and he did an excellent job.    .  It was pleasant to see Meena again as a smart village lady but nothing much to perform.   The character of Meena was artificial than real.  Here the writer failed for sure but he did it for the central theme.  The 3 child artists were good.   The entire comedy lobby of actors tried to do their best where Innocent, Salim Kumar, Jagatheesh, Sooraj & Kottayam Naseer were brilliant but Jagathy and Mamookoya were wasted.  KPAC Lalitha as School headmistress did justice to her role.


The poetry - song "Vyathyasthanaamoru barbaraam..." was good only because of the vyathyasthatha brought by it, otherwise the music department was not that good.   The only other song "Mambilli Kavil" was below average.


Cinematography of the film is superb.  Normally we could see the beauty of Kerala from other language films, especially Tamil films.  Only few directors manage to stamp the beauty of Kerala in their films.   In this film the cinematographer P Sukumar gave eternity to few good scenes.    Very good work there!


The movie is produced by Sreenivasan along with another actor Mukesh and surely laughing loud with money and fame.


Overall, the movie stands different for its variety in theme selection and top class climax.   It would have easily ended up as a light entertainer but a genius gave his touch and the touch was sufficient to make it as a good one.  There is a lesson for one who wish to learn….but did they learn?


At the end of the review, the question remains…does good deeds INC pay its dividends well?  I am sure one who see the movie will find the answer is easy where I can see you guessed it right…still watch it if you get a chance…otherwise wait for a remake to Tamil and probably to Hindi on another day…another year…
